Yes, but sadly Vantive has confused the market with their product positioning in SFA against Sebl, rather than against Clfy in customer support. There is a difference between Customer Support and Sales Force Automation. Some companies require a full-suite of products, which both Vantive and Sebl have, but this expected convergence hasn't happened as quickly as expected. Vantive now finds itself competing for stand-alone SFA deals against Sebl...where Vantive is likely to lose. In customer support Vantive competes for stand alone deals against Clfy, where Clfy is now reinvigorated and where Vantive has somewhat let down it's guard by neglecting that segment in favor of SFA.
